How can students identify universities with strong academic progression support?

1. Research University Support Services


- Academic Advising: Check if the university offers dedicated academic advisors or personal tutors who guide students on course selection, academic challenges, and career planning.
- Learning Support Centers: Look for writing centers, math labs, or learning resource centers that provide one-on-one tutoring or group workshops.
- Orientation & Induction Programs: Strong universities offer comprehensive orientation sessions to help international students acclimate academically and socially.

2. Review University Rankings & Student Satisfaction


- Rankings for Student Support: Some global rankings (like QS or THE) assess universities on student support and learning environment.
- Student Testimonials: Read student reviews on platforms like Studyportals, WhatUni, or the university’s own website. Look for comments about academic support and progression.

3. Ask About Progression Pathways


- Foundation & Pathway Programs: If you require additional preparation, check if the university offers foundation or pathway programs with guaranteed progression to degree courses.
- Academic Progression Policies: Review policies for moving from undergraduate to postgraduate levels or switching majors, which reflect the university’s flexibility and support.

4. Check Support for International Students


- Dedicated International Student Office: Universities with an active international office usually offer tailored academic and pastoral support, visa guidance, and language assistance.
- Language Support: Many universities provide English language classes, writing workshops, and proof-reading services.

5. Explore Peer Mentoring & Networking Opportunities


- Mentorship Programs: Universities with peer mentoring (senior students guiding newcomers) often have better progression outcomes.
- Student Societies & Clubs: Opportunities to join subject-specific societies can enhance learning and networking.

6. Look for Career and Employability Services


- Career Guidance: Access to internships, career counseling, and job fairs are indicators of strong support for academic and professional progression.
- Alumni Success: High graduate employability rates often reflect strong academic and career support.
